-
用js进行url编码后用php反解以及用php实现js的escape功能函数总结
本文是一个php实现的js escape功能函数,即:用php解析js escape编码的字符串,感兴趣的同学参考下。 这次第一次用smarttemplate这个模板,比smarty小巧了很多,但也有些不方便的地方...
PHP 2014-12-09 13:03:04 -
php 图像处理函数总结
本文为大家整理总结一php中的图像处理函数,并注解了其功能用法,感兴趣的同学参考下. PHP自4.3版本开始,捆绑了自己的GD2库,用户可以自己下载并设置.如果要查看自己的php版本是否支持gd模块(支持JPEG,PNG,WBMP但不再支持GIF) 如下方式是一种方法: if(!function_exists('imagecreate')) { die('本服务器不支持GD模块'); } 如果不支持的话,如何配置 ? 下载gd模块的dll文件,修改php.ini,重启服务器即可. 以下简称PHP作图为PS. 当您打算 PS的话,应该完成如下如下步骤,这是必经的. 1:创建基本PS对象(我假设为$image),填充背景(默认黑),以后的全部ps操作都是基于这个背景图像的. 2:在$image上作图. 3:输出这个图像. 4:销毁对象,清除使用内存. 首先,我们来认识几个常用的函数,这些函数在php手册里面都有详细介绍,此处大体引用下. resource imagecreate ( int x_size, int y_size...
PHP 2014-12-09 09:15:04 -
PHP开发中常用函数总结
本文为大家总结了一些php开发中的常用函数,感兴趣的同学参考下。 1.打印数组函数 function _print($array) { echo ("<pre>"); print_r($array); echo ("</pre>"); } 2.截取字串 func_chgtitle function func_chgtitle($str,$len) { if(strlen($str)>$len) { $tmpstr = ""; $strlen = $len; for($i = 0; $i < $strlen; $i++) { if(ord(substr($str, $i, 1)) > 0xa0) { $tmpstr .= substr($str, $i, 2); $i++; } else $tmpstr .= substr($str, $i, 1); } return $tmpstr."&quo...
PHP 2014-12-08 09:45:05 -
php采集函数总结及示例
本文为大家整理总结了一些php采集函数,并以示例的方式向大家讲解了用法,感兴趣的同学参考下。 在做一些天气预报或者RSS订阅的程序时,往往需要抓取非本地文件,一般情况下都是利用php模拟浏览器的访问,通过http请求访问url地址,然后得到html源代码或者xml数据...
PHP 2014-12-08 01:21:03 -
PHP打开获取远程URL地址的几种方法总结
本文为大家整理总结了PHP打开获取远程URL地址内容的几种方法:file_get_content,curl,fopen,fsockopen等,感兴趣的同学参考下。 1: 用file_get_contents 以get方式获取内容 <?php $url='http://www.baidu.com/'; $html = file_get_contents($url); //print_r($http_response_header); ec($html); printhr(); printarr($http_response_header); printhr(); ?> 示例代码2: 用fopen打开url, 以get方式获取内容 <? $fp = fopen($url, 'r'); printarr(stream_get_meta_data($fp)); printhr(); while(!feof($fp)) { $result .= fgets($fp, 1024); }...
PHP 2014-12-08 00:21:06 -
编程入门:浅谈C语言的可变参数 有经验者看了就懂
C语言中有些函数使用可变参数,比如常见的int printf( const char* format, ...),第一个参数format是固定的,其余的参数的个数和类型都不固定。 C语言用va_start等宏来处理这些可变参数...
系统程序 2014-12-07 22:15:04 -
PHP技术开发技巧总结
本文为大家整理了一些php的开发技巧,感兴趣的同学参考下。 1. 提高PHP的运行效率 PHP的优点之一是速度很快,对于一般的网站应用,可以说是已经足够了...
PHP 2014-12-07 18:53:21 -
php连接数据库示例及函数总结
本文为大家整理了php连接数据库的示例及函数总结,感兴趣的同学参考下。 <?php $db_host='hostname is database server '; $db_database='database name'; $db_username='username'; $db_password='password'; $connection=mysql_connect($db_host,$db_username,$db_password);//连接到数据库 mysql_query("set names 'utf8'");//编码转化 if(!$connection){ die("could not connect to the database:</br>".mysql_error());//诊断连接错误 } $db_selecct=mysql_select_db($db_database);//选择数据库 if...
PHP 2014-12-07 12:48:04 -
提高PHP编程效率的53个要点总结
本文是一篇php开发经验谈,为大家介绍的是提高PHP编程效率的53个要点总结,感兴趣的同学参考下。 用单引号代替双引号来包含字符串,这样做会更快一些...
PHP 2014-12-07 09:51:03 -
php运算符的知识总结大全
本文为大家整理总结了php运算符的知识大全,感兴趣的同学参考下 看似简单的东西,在实际运用中,还是很有意思的 算术运算符 运算符 名称 结果 $a + $b 加法 $a 和 $b 的和 $a - $b 减法 $a 和 $b 的差 $a * $b 乘法 $a 和 $b 的积 $a / $b 除法 $a 除以 $b 的商 $a % $b 取模 $a 除以 $b 的余数 递增/递减运算符 运算符 名称 结果 ++$a 前加 $a 的值加一,然后进行操作 $a++ 后加 $a 的值先进行操作,后加一 --$a 前减 $a 的值减一,然后进行操作 $a-- 后减 $a 的值先进行操作,后减一 实例: <?php echo $a=5+”5th”; //输出:10 echo 10%3; //输出:1 echo 10+ $a++; //输出:20 echo 5- --$a; //输出:-5 ?> 比较运算符 运算符 名称 结果 $a == $b 等于 TRUE,如...
PHP 2014-12-07 05:30:04 -
php 错误处理经验分享
本文为大家分享的是php 错误处理经验,感兴趣的同学参考下。 在创建脚本和 web 应用程序时,错误处理是一个重要的部分...
PHP 2014-12-07 01:21:05